Immunotherapy offers a promising treatment for advanced gastric cancer (GC) by stimulating immune responses. This review highlights recent advancements, challenges, and future strategies for effective GC immunotherapy.
Area of Science:
- Oncology
- Immunology
- Gastroenterology
Background:
- Gastric carcinoma (GC) is a leading cause of cancer death globally, with complex symptoms hindering early detection.
- Advanced or metastatic GC treatment has seen significant progress with immune checkpoint inhibition.
- Immunotherapy presents an effective, tolerable alternative to traditional therapies for GC.
Purpose of the Study:
- To review recent advancements in immunotherapy for advanced gastric cancer.
- To examine current clinical applications of immunotherapies for GC.
- To address challenges and explore future strategies in GC immunotherapy.
Main Methods:
- Review of current literature on advanced gastric cancer immunotherapies.
- Analysis of immune checkpoint inhibitors, cancer vaccines, VEGF-A inhibitors, and CAR T-cell therapy.
- Discussion of clinical trial data and therapeutic outcomes.
Main Results:
- Immunotherapy demonstrates significant effectiveness and tolerable toxicity in advanced GC.
- Various immunotherapeutic strategies are under investigation in clinical trials.
- Immune checkpoint inhibitors are a new standard for advanced GC treatment.
Conclusions:
- Immunotherapy is a rapidly advancing and effective treatment modality for advanced gastric cancer.
- Addressing current challenges is crucial for optimizing immunotherapy outcomes.
- Future strategies hold promise for overcoming limitations in GC immunotherapy.
